Output 43b27a6614aeb546a128c24a27b11153245b190e022eb9aaef8f592d4463016d:1

value
6995773
script pubkey
OP_0 OP_PUSHBYTES_20 e18263888e69f7de6cc9da7f66afae8b1018e8e9
address
bc1quxpx8zywd8maumxfmflkdtaw3vgp368f4kzdps
transaction
43b27a6614aeb546a128c24a27b11153245b190e022eb9aaef8f592d4463016d
spent
true